Necessary Maintenance Tips for UPVC Doors
To keep your UPVC doors in tip-top shape, think about the following maintenance ideas divided into areas: cleaning, lubrication, assessment, and repair.
Cleaning Your UPVC Doors
Cleaning is an important step in the maintenance of UPVC doors. Regular cleansing prevents dirt build-up and keeps the doors looking brand-new.
Advised Cleaning Schedule:
| Frequency | Job Description |
|---|---|
| Weekly | Wipe down the surface with a soft cloth and mild soapy water. |
| Month-to-month | Clean the frame and look for any staining or spots. |
| Bi-annually | Deep clean and remove any dirt or grime accumulation in grooves. |
Cleaning up Steps:
- Use a Mild Soap: Mix a couple of drops of liquid soap with warm water.
- Soft Cloth or Sponge: Use a non-abrasive cloth to avoid scratching the surface area.
- Rinse Thoroughly: After cleansing, rinse with water to get rid of soap residue.
- Dry Completely: Use a soft cloth to dry the door to prevent water areas.
Lubrication
Proper lubrication is essential for the optimal performance of your UPVC door. Hinges and locks that are not sufficiently lubricated can end up being stiff, leading to difficulties in operation.
Lubrication Schedule:
| Frequency | Job Description |
|---|---|
| Every 6 months | Oil hinges, locks, and moving parts. |
| Annually | Examine all locking systems and adjust as needed. |
Lubrication Steps:
- Choose the Right Lubricant: Use a silicone-based spray or graphite powder rather than oil-based lubes, which can bring in dirt and gunk.
- Apply Lubricant: Spray or use the lube to hinges, locks, and all moving parts.
- Clean Excess: Use a fabric to eliminate any excess lubricant to avoid accumulation.
Examination
Routine assessments assist recognize prospective issues before they become major problems.
What to Inspect:
- Gaskets and Seals: Check for signs of wear and tear, and replace if necessary.
- Hinges and Mechanisms: Ensure hinges run efficiently and look for any rust or corrosion.
- Locking Mechanism: Test the lock to ensure it engages and disengages smoothly.
- Surface area Condition: Look for cracks, chips, or dents.
Examination Schedule:
| Frequency | Job Description |
|---|---|
| Bi-annually | Complete comprehensive check of the door components. |
| Every year | Inspect gaskets and seals for signs of aging. |
Repairing Common Issues
Regardless of solid maintenance, problems might still occur. Here are a few common problems with UPVC doors and their services.
Typical Issues and Solutions:
| Issue | Option |
|---|---|
| Door not closing properly | Examine alignment; adjust hinges if essential. |
| Drafts or leakages around the door | Change worn or damaged seals and gaskets. |
| Stiff or stuck door | Oil hinges and locking mechanisms. |
| Cracks or scratches on the frame | Use a vinyl repair kit to complete cracks or contact a professional for serious damage. |
